Lysine, Tyrosine, and Beans, OH MY! Amino Acids and how to get 'em!
Amino acids are a group of 20 organic molecules that are the building blocks of proteins. Just as protein can be found in nearly every area of the body, amino acids are vital to the healthy functioning of nearly every tissue in the human body.

How to Build Strong Bones for Life
Did you know that bones are living tissues? Although we often think of bones as lifeless mineral structures, they are, in fact, dynamic tissues that are constantly changing throughout our lifespan.
Intuitive Eating: The Pros and Cons
Have you heard about intuitive eating? While intuition is a timeless concept applicable to all areas of life, two dietitians coined the term "intuitive eating" in the 1990s. They developed a framework to provide a new approach to eating that would help people find freedom from restrictive diet culture.

The Mesomorph Series: The Ultimate Lean Bulk Plan
The three most common body types, or "somatotypes," are mesomorph, ectomorph, and endomorph. Understanding the three body types with their different body compositions, body shapes, bone structures, and metabolic rates helps nutritionists and personal trainers design effective, personalized workout routines and meal plans.
